Product Specifications |
|
Model Number |
CN3300 Dual Radio Access Point/Controller • Power supply and antennas sold separately |
|
Software Configurable Radio |
Dual radio selectable for IEEE 802.11 a, b or g operation |
|
Status LEDs |
WLAN and LAN activity indicators; power indicator |
|
Network Ports |
(2) Auto-sensing 802.3 10/100 BASE-T Ethernet |
|
Antenna Connectors |
(4) Reverse polarity male SMA with diversity |
|
Power Inputs |
DC connector: 5 VDC (power supply sold separately) RJ45 Ethernet: 48 VDC +/- 10% (802.3af compliant) |
|
Power Requirements |
8.6 Watts, max. |
|
Temperature Range |
Operating: 0° C to 50° C, Storage: -40° C to 80° C |
|
Humidity |
5% to 95% typical (non-condensing) |
|
Safety Compliance |
IEC 60950, UL 1950 and 2043, CSA 22.2 No. 950-95, EN 60950 |
|
Overall Physical Dimensions |
H: 47.752 mm, (1.880 in); L: 165.735 mm, (6.525 in); W: 162.560 mm, (6.400 in); Shipping Weight: 1.4 Kg, (3.0 lbs) |

Networking Specifications |
|
Networking |
QoS: 802.1p VLAN priority; SpectraLink SVP; 802.11 EDCA; Service-aware QoS |
| DHCP: Server (RFC 2131), Client, Relay, Option 82 (RFC3046) |
| DNS Relay; SMTP Redirection; Stateful Firewall |
| Bridging and Routing: IEEE 802.11d bridging; Static routing; RIP v1 (RFC 1058) and v2 (RFC 1723); Generic route encapsulation (RFC 2784) |
| Address Management: NAT (RFC 1631); Colubris Networks Adaptive NATTM; CIDR (RFC 1519) |
Other: RADIUS Client (RFC 2865 and 2866); PPPoE Client (RFC 2516); ICMP (RFC 792); IEEE 802.1q VLAN Tagging; Wireless Distribution System (WDS); Layer 2 wireless client isolation; Per user/SSID bandwidth limiting |
|
Network Management |
Fully manageable with Colubris Networks Management System (CNMS) |
SNMP v1 and v2: MIB-II with TRAPS; Colubris Networks extensions for user session control and downstream AP management; RADIUS Authentication MIB (RFC 2618); RIP v2 extension MIB (RFC 1724) |
| Embedded web GUI management tool with secure access (SSL and VPN) |
| Packet capture and trace facility |
| Scheduled configuration upgrades from central server; downloadable firmware |
|
Access Control Functions |
-
SSL protected Web-based authentication (UAM)
-
Static and dynamic WEP keys of 40 bits and 128 bits
-
802.1x using PEAP, EAP-TLS, EAP-TTLS, or EAP-SIM authentication
-
MAC address authentication
-
Wi-Fi Protected Access (WPA), software upgradeable to 802.11i/AES |
| Web: Web-proxy server; Support for centralized portal |
| Fixed-IP address spoofing |
| AAA Security: RADIUS using EAP-MD5, PAP, CHAP, MSCHAP v2 |
| Capacity: Up to 100 concurrent subscribers |
|
WLAN Monitor |
Automatic rogue detection and trap generation; Reports discrepancies from lost of known APs |
| Real-time status information and protocol traces; Co-channel interference detection |
